can't say for yamp, but I know that media player runs fine from cd-rw or dvd. If you go to the xbox media player homepage here you should find what you need.

Here is a config file to get you started that I have used to run from disk...

<configuration>

           <media>

              <map>E:,Harddisk0\Partition1</map>

              <local>D:\Media\Video</local>
              <remote>192.168.1.2</remote>
             
           </media>

</configuration>
